operator bool -- <ranges> view_interfaceを追加 #713

1 · cpprefjp · Sept. 1, 2021, 5:53 p.m.
diff --git a/reference/ranges/view_interface/op_bool.md b/reference/ranges/view_interface/op_bool.md new file mode 100644 index 000000000..e567bec9c --- /dev/null +++ b/reference/ranges/view_interface/op_bool.md @@ -0,0 +1,47 @@ +# operator bool +* ranges[meta header] +* std::ranges[meta namespace] +* view_interface[meta class] +* function[meta id-type] +* cpp20[meta cpp] + +```cpp + constexpr explicit operator bool() requires requires { ranges::empty(derived()); }; // (1) + constexp...